Transaction d882ab779fa2df27cf773fbebde41cb392626ad286f34195470d5f4811f1e1e8
1 Input
1 Output
-
d882ab779fa2df27cf773fbebde41cb392626ad286f34195470d5f4811f1e1e8:0
- value
- 664461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ae21ff9943ecc6467a97f5ea88d09fddaea4b2a5 OP_EQUAL
- address
- 3HZkEB662rrmHJxmhBYmUW5s8E4BZPa6vF